As Corporate Secretary, you will serve as the operational backbone of Securitize's Board governance function. Reporting to the General Counsel, you'll own the end-to-end management of Board and committee meetings, ensure compliance with SEC regulations and NYSE listing standards, and serve as the critical link between the Board, executive leadership, and external stakeholders. Precision, discretion, and institutional knowledge are the foundation of this role.

What You’ll Do
Board & Committee Operations
  • Own all logistics, agendas, materials, and minutes for Board and committee meetings (Audit, Compensation, Nominating/Governance)
  • Draft, review, and distribute resolutions, written consents, and Board packages
  • Maintain all official corporate records, charters, committee calendars, and governance policies
SEC & NYSE Compliance
  • Ensure ongoing compliance with SEC regulations and NYSE listing requirements as the company transitions to public markets
  • Coordinate Section 16 reporting (Forms 3, 4,
    5) and administer the insider trading compliance program
  • Support preparation of proxy statements, annual meeting materials, and related regulatory filings
Shareholder & Annual Meeting Management
  • Manage the Annual Meeting of Shareholders end-to-end — logistics, materials, voting, and Q&A preparation
  • Serve as primary liaison with the transfer agent, proxy advisors, and institutional shareholders
Cross-Functional Support
  • Partner with Legal, Finance, IR, and HR on governance matters, disclosures, and corporate actions
  • Support M&A activity, financing transactions, and other strategic initiatives requiring Board approvals
What You Bring
  • 5–10 years of corporate secretarial or governance experience; public company or pre-IPO experience strongly preferred
  • Deep working knowledge of SEC rules, proxy regulations, and NYSE listing standards
  • Proven ability to support Boards and senior executives with high-stakes, confidential materials
  • Exceptional organizational skills and meticulous attention to detail under tight deadlines
  • Strong written communication skills — you draft clearly and concisely
  • Experience with governance platforms (Board vantage or equivalent) preferred
  • Paralegal certificate, ICSA/CGI certification, or JD a plus
